At the Institute and Faculty of Actuaries’ (IFoA) Annual General Meeting on 26 June 2019, the new President John Taylor launched our new certificate in Data Science.

Available in 2020, the standalone online Certificate in Data Science will be available to members at all stages of their careers, wherever they are located across the globe.

It will focus on areas such as Data Visualisation, Machine Learning, AI and Ethics, and the relevance of these to the future work of our members in established and newer areas of actuarial work. As this is such a fast-moving field, it is expected that Certificate holders will also need to demonstrate relevant elements of continuing professional development (CPD) within their normal annual CPD requirement.

We will be finalising development of the Certificate over the next few months and expect enrolment to start in March 2020. More details will be available on our website shortly, alongside an opportunity to express interest in registering for this credential.

This Certificate builds on the huge range of data science activities conducted by the IFoA over recent years, ranging from our Data Science Summit in 2017 and a strategic data science partnership with the Royal Statistical Society, to our hugely successful virtual conference in 2019.

The IFoA Certificate in Data Science will demonstrate the unique value for members arising from the synergy between the domains of actuarial and data science.
